要实现内容滚动而不是整个页面滚动,可以通过CSS和JavaScript来实现。以下是一种常见的实现方式:
.container {
height: 300px;
overflow: scroll; /* 或者使用 overflow: auto; */
}
<div class="container">
<div class="content">
<!-- 这里放置你的内容 -->
</div>
</div>
var content = document.querySelector('.content');
var container = document.querySelector('.container');
container.style.height = content.offsetHeight + 'px';
这样,当内容超出容器高度时,容器就会出现滚动条,只有容器内的内容会滚动,而不是整个页面。
以上是一种基本的实现方式,具体实现还可以根据具体需求进行调整和扩展。
领取专属 10元无门槛券
手把手带您无忧上云